query.rs1use std::fmt::{self, Debug, Display, Formatter};
2use std::ops::{Deref, DerefMut};
3
4use salvo_core::extract::{Extractible, Metadata};
5use salvo_core::http::ParseError;
6use salvo_core::{Depot, Request};
7use serde::{Deserialize, Deserializer};
8
9use crate::endpoint::EndpointArgRegister;
10use crate::{Components, Operation, Parameter, ParameterIn, ToSchema};
11
12pub struct QueryParam<T, const REQUIRED: bool = true>(Option<T>);
14impl<T> QueryParam<T, true> {
15 pub fn into_inner(self) -> T {
17 self.0.expect("`QueryParam<T, true>` into_inner get `None`")
18 }
19}
20impl<T> QueryParam<T, false> {
21 pub fn into_inner(self) -> Option<T> {
23 self.0
24 }
25}
26
27impl<T> Deref for QueryParam<T, true> {
28 type Target = T;
29
30 fn deref(&self) -> &Self::Target {
31 self.0
32 .as_ref()
33 .expect("`QueryParam<T, true>` defref get `None`")
34 }
35}
36impl<T> Deref for QueryParam<T, false> {
37 type Target = Option<T>;
38
39 fn deref(&self) -> &Self::Target {
40 &self.0
41 }
42}
43
44impl<T> DerefMut for QueryParam<T, true> {
45 fn deref_mut(&mut self) -> &mut Self::Target {
46 self.0
47 .as_mut()
48 .expect("`QueryParam<T, true>` defref_mut get `None`")
49 }
50}
51impl<T> DerefMut for QueryParam<T, false> {
52 fn deref_mut(&mut self) -> &mut Self::Target {
53 &mut self.0
54 }
55}
56
57impl<'de, T, const R: bool> Deserialize<'de> for QueryParam<T, R>
58where
59 T: Deserialize<'de>,
60{
61 fn deserialize<D>(deserializer: D) -> Result<Self, D::Error>
62 where
63 D: Deserializer<'de>,
64 {
65 T::deserialize(deserializer).map(|value| Self(Some(value)))
66 }
67}
68
69impl<T: Debug, const R: bool> Debug for QueryParam<T, R> {
70 f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
71 self.0.fmt(f)
72 }
73}
74
75impl<T: Display> Display for QueryParam<T, true> {
76 fn fmt(&self, f: &mut Formatter<'_>) -> fmt::Result {
77 self.0
78 .as_ref()
79 .expect("`QueryParam<T, true>` as_ref get `None`")
80 .fmt(f)
81 }
82}
83
84impl<'ex, T> Extractible<'ex> for QueryParam<T, true>
85where
86 T: Deserialize<'ex>,
87{
88 fn metadata() -> &'static Metadata {
89 static METADATA: Metadata = Metadata::new("");
90 &METADATA
91 }
92 #[allow(refining_impl_trait)]
93 async fn extract(_req: &'ex mut Request, _depot: &'ex mut Depot) -> Result<Self, ParseError> {
94 panic!("query parameter can not be extracted from request")
95 }
96 #[allow(refining_impl_trait)]
97 async fn extract_with_arg(
98 req: &'ex mut Request,
99 _depot: &'ex mut Depot,
100 arg: &str,
101 ) -> Result<Self, ParseError> {
102 let value = req.query(arg).ok_or_else(|| {
103 ParseError::other(format!(
104 "query parameter {arg} not found or convert to type failed"
105 ))
106 })?;
107 Ok(Self(value))
108 }
109}
110impl<'ex, T> Extractible<'ex> for QueryParam<T, false>
111where
112 T: Deserialize<'ex>,
113{
114 fn metadata() -> &'static Metadata {
115 static METADATA: Metadata = Metadata::new("");
116 &METADATA
117 }
118 #[allow(refining_impl_trait)]
119 async fn extract(_req: &'ex mut Request, _depot: &'ex mut Depot) -> Result<Self, ParseError> {
120 panic!("query parameter can not be extracted from request")
121 }
122 #[allow(refining_impl_trait)]
123 async fn extract_with_arg(
124 req: &'ex mut Request,
125 _depot: &'ex mut Depot,
126 arg: &str,
127 ) -> Result<Self, ParseError> {
128 Ok(Self(req.query(arg)))
129 }
130}
131
132impl<T, const R: bool> EndpointArgRegister for QueryParam<T, R>
133where
134 T: ToSchema,
135{
136 fn register(components: &mut Components, operation: &mut Operation, arg: &str) {
137 let parameter = Parameter::new(arg)
138 .parameter_in(ParameterIn::Query)
139 .description(format!("Get parameter `{arg}` from request url query."))
140 .schema(T::to_schema(components))
141 .required(R);
142 operation.parameters.insert(parameter);
143 }
144}
